Bottom line

Luxor is the warmer of the two — about 29°F on the annual average; Nuremberg is the wetter, with 23 in more rain a year, and Luxor the sunnier.

Warmer Luxor 29°F on the year
Wetter Nuremberg 23 in more a year
Sunnier Luxor 53 pp less cloud
Colder winters Nuremberg 17°F colder nights

Methodology & sources

Nuremberg

Temperature & precipitation — 1991–2020 normals computed from 30 years of daily observations at Nurnberg, a weather station, about 6 km from the city centre. The underlying daily records come from NOAA's global station network.

Cloud, humidity, wind & sunshine — modelled estimates from NASA POWER, NASA's satellite-and-reanalysis climatology. This is the standard global source for atmospheric variables, which are not measured at most weather stations.

Luxor

Temperature & precipitation — 1991–2020 normals computed from 30 years of daily observations at Luxor Intl, a weather station, about 7 km from the city centre. The underlying daily records come from NOAA's global station network.

Cloud, humidity, wind & sunshine — modelled estimates from NASA POWER, NASA's satellite-and-reanalysis climatology. This is the standard global source for atmospheric variables, which are not measured at most weather stations.
